We recruit WRs based on body type rather than overall ability. They just want big bodies that can grab the 50-50 balls and someone to block down field. The bombs we threw in early games was due to the complete lack of talent on those defenses. We have average speed at best, at that position. When we’ve played the best defenses, these WRs have been locked down. Some of its due to no respect for our run game, defenses only bring 4-5 and drop everyone else back, some of its due to half decent DBs in man to man.

Talking about qbs, I don’t think I’ve seen our qbs throw the ball out of bounds one time based on nobody being open. That’s a reflection of coaching.

We could actually use Grossman and Parham in the short pass game, maybe quicker than I give em credit for. However, we have no intention of putting athletes on the field.
